Stephen Eglen <S.J.Eglen@damtp.cam.ac.uk> writes:
Hi Stephen,
> When iswitchb opens teach, it uses find-file-noselect, which opens the
> file 'teaching.org' with that name as the buffer, rather than using
> the name 'teach'. The fix then is to tell iswitchb to use the name
> returned by find-file-noselect. I've attached a new version of the
> function iswitchb-read-buffer - please can you test it to see that it
> solves the problem for you Tassilo, and then I'll commit a patch.
It works.
> I guess the only issue is whether the buffer should be called the name
> of the symlink 'teach' or the name of the real file 'teaching.org' -
> is there a way to tell Emacs to prefer the symlink name?
I prefer the real file's name, because that's the way `find-file'
handles it. The current version does exactly that, and I'm happy with
it. :-)
